$617M Financing Package Secured for Grubb Properties' NYC Development
Event summary
- $617 million in total capitalization secured for Grubb Properties-managed REITs and Manhattan development.
- Three-phase advisory effort involved M&A, corporate banking, and debt/equity teams.
- $240 million NAV credit facility from Bayview supports 45-property portfolio consolidation.
- $377 million in construction/mezzanine financing arranged for Link Apartments 8 Carlisle.
- 64-story Manhattan development includes 30% affordable housing under legacy 421-a program.
